Texas National Guard

The Texas National Guard consists of the:
*Texas Army National Guard
*Texas Air National Guard

The Guard is administered by the adjutant general, an appointee of the governor of Texas.

In 1952, Texas Railroad Commissioner Ernest O. Thompson, was promoted to lieutenant general over the Texas Guard. Thompson was also an expert in petroleum issues and a former mayor of Amarillo.
